I usually like to point out how quick recipes take, so you are not discouraged from giving them a try. But in the case of Coffee Ice Cream, the longer it takes, the better! Mix the milk, cream, sugar, salt, and whole coffee beans in a pot, and heat in a pot until the ice cream base is warm and steamy, and the aroma permeates through the kitchen and around the house. If you love coffee, the smell of that creamy coffee mixture steeping for an hour will make you want to snuggle up on the couch with a blanket and read a good book. It might be for ice cream, but it warms the soul.
